1. What is Zoferty Infotech?

Zoferty Infotech operates in the EdTech sector, providing online and classroom-based job- and career-oriented courses. The brand targets students and working professionals seeking skill enhancement and career advancement. As part of the educational material and services franchise category, Zoferty Infotech offers structured learning programs and business partnership opportunities across India.

Business Concept

The brand combines technology-driven learning with traditional classroom support, allowing franchise partners to operate as distributors or channel partners while supporting student enrollments and providing educational resources.

2. How the Business Works

Franchise partners promote and sell Zoferty Infotech’s courses, either online or in collaboration with classroom programs. Students interact with the brand via online platforms or training centers. Revenue is generated through course enrollment fees, with franchisees earning a percentage of each sale. Partners are supported with lead management, training, and marketing tools.

8. Revenue Model and Profit Considerations

Revenue is earned through course sales, with franchisees receiving up to 60% profit per enrollment. Demand is driven by the increasing need for job-oriented skills and career advancement. Recurring revenue is possible through multiple course enrollments, with minimal operational costs enhancing profitability. Payback is typically less than three months.
